#Jamaica, July 27, 2023 – Jill Stewart, wife of millionaire hotelier Adam Stewart, has died.

Stewart, who is the son of celebrated tourism mogul and Sandals Group founder Gordon ‘Butch’ Stewart, made the announcement himself via Twitter.

“It is almost unimaginable that it has come to this. Still, with unbearable grief and a broken heart, I let you know that my wife Jill, the love of my life, my best friend of 28 years, and mother of our three wonderful children passed away peacefully and surrounded by love,” he said on July 15th.

Jill Stewart was born in The Bahamas and moved to Jamaica in 2005 to be with her husband. She had been diagnosed with liposarcoma (a rare type of cancer that develops in your fatty tissue), a little over a year before her death. The teenage sweethearts, as described by Adam, had been married for 14 years and shared three children.

Sandals is one of the Turks and Caicos’ largest employers and the group acts as community builders sponsoring various social events.
